The Washington Commanders entered Week 15 knowing that they couldn’t move down from the 7th seed in the NFC, but they could get some help getting to the 6th seed. The Green Bay Packers defeated the Seattle Seahawks on Sunday Night Football, keeping Washington at the 7th seed for another week. The Commanders can move up to the 6th seed next week with a win at home against the Philadelphia Eagles, and a Packers loss to the Saints. Washington would hold the conference tie breaker(7-3 vs 5-5 NFC). Geaux Saints!
Washington could get up to the 5th seed the following week, but they’d need a Vikings losing streak, and a big win over the Philadelphia Eagles. We’ll look into that more next week if Minnesota somehow loses to the Bears tonight.
The Detroit Lions lost to the Buffalo Bills and the Philadelphia Eagles beat the Pittsburgh Steelers. That gives them both a 12-2 record, but the Lions keep the top spot for now due to tie-breakers.
The Washington Commanders are 9-5, and holding off most of the weak NFC. The Seattle Seahawks dropped to 8th place after their loss, with the Los Angeles Rams moving into the lead in the NFC West, and the 4th seed. Washington holds the conference tie breaker(6-3 vs 4-5 NFC), and would need to lose two, and two Seahawks wins, to drop out of the 7th seed. The Tampa Bay Buccaneers would hold the head-to-head tiebreaker against Washington, but they’re currently leading the NFC South, and the 3rd seed.
